Alongside is a global digital product and engineering agency that partners with organizations to build software products and augment development teams. With offices in the USA, Portugal, India, and Vietnam, they offer team-building, product development, and consulting services to help clients take projects from concept to delivery.
• Build and maintain data pipelines that ingest real-time positioning and telemetry data from tracking hardware. • Design data models and schemas that support real-time event detection (e.g., correlating two tracked objects' positions to infer a pickup or handoff event). • Implement data quality checks, monitoring, and alerting to catch pipeline failures or data drift early. • Optimize pipelines for near-real-time processing at the latency the product requires. • Work with structured and semi-structured data coming from external hardware and API integrations. • Collaborate with software engineers to ensure data is accessible, reliable, and supports platform features. • Support deployment, monitoring, and troubleshooting of data pipelines in production.
• 2–5 years of professional Data Engineering or Software Engineering experience. • Hands-on experience building and maintaining data pipelines (batch or streaming/ETL-ELT). • Solid SQL and relational database skills; comfort with event or time-series data is a plus. • Experience integrating with third-party APIs and webhooks. • Comfortable working with real-time or near-real-time data processing requirements. • Experience with a major cloud platform (Azure preferred). • Strong communication skills and comfort working in a small, cross-functional, fast-moving team. • Nice to Have: Experience with geospatial or positioning data (GPS, BLE, RTLS). • Nice to Have: Experience with message queues or event streaming (e.g., Kafka, Azure Service Bus). • Nice to Have: Background in industrial, logistics, or IoT domains.
• Remote work (Portugal-based) • Estimated project duration: 19 weeks • Full-time schedule: 8 hours per day, with mandatory availability for at least 4 hours • Freelance / Service Agreement • Hourly Rate: 31€-33€
